Identifying Contaminants in Your Water
The presence of pharmaceuticals in water often stems from improper disposal of medications and wastewater discharges. Microplastics, tiny plastic particles that result from the breakdown of larger plastic items, can be transported into water supplies through runoff and pollution. While these contaminants may be invisible to the naked eye, their effects can be significant.
To determine the quality of your home water, homeowners can begin by conducting a simple water test. Testing kits are available that allow you to collect samples and send them to a lab for analysis. If your water tests high for contaminants, you can then take appropriate steps to address the issue.
How Reverse Osmosis Works
One of the most effective solutions for eliminating pharmaceuticals and microplastics from your drinking water is a reverse osmosis (RO) filtration system. This technology uses a semi-permeable membrane to separate impurities from water, allowing only clean water molecules to pass through. As a result, contaminants such as pharmaceuticals and microplastics are effectively filtered out, providing you with peace of mind in every glass.
Understanding System Sizing and Capacity
Choosing the right reverse osmosis system for your needs is critical. Systems are available in various sizes and capacities, typically rated by gallons per day (GPD), which indicates how much purified water the system can produce daily. Additionally, consider factors such as grain capacity and tank size, which influence the amount of water that can be stored and accessed on demand. A typical household may benefit from a system with a capacity tailored to their daily water consumption to ensure adequate supply throughout the day.
Maintenance for Optimal Performance
Regular maintenance is essential for ensuring that your reverse osmosis system operates effectively. Routine tasks include replacing filters at recommended intervals—typically every six months to a year, depending on usage and water quality. Additionally, sanitizing the system and checking for any leaks or wear in the tubing should be done periodically to avoid potential issues that could compromise water quality.
What to Consider Before Purchasing
- Water Quality: Get an understanding of your current water quality by conducting initial tests to identify specific contaminants present.
- Capacity Requirements: Determine your household’s water consumption to select a system that meets your daily needs.
- Space Availability: Consider where you will install the RO system and ensure there is enough space for the unit and storage tank.
- Filter Replacement: Investigate how often filters need to be changed and what the associated costs will be for ongoing maintenance.
Avoiding Common Mistakes
When purchasing a reverse osmosis system, it’s easy to overlook critical details that can impact performance. One common mistake is underestimating the necessary flow rate; if the system cannot keep up with demand, you may find yourself without access to purified water when you need it most. Additionally, failing to consider the quality of post-filtration water can lead to unexpected tastes or odors, suggesting that regular maintenance has been neglected.

Understanding the Technology Behind Reverse Osmosis
Reverse osmosis (RO) technology operates on the principle of pushing water through a semi-permeable membrane that allows only water molecules to pass while blocking larger molecules and contaminants. This process results in highly purified water that is free of many impurities, making it an excellent choice for both drinking water and cooking.
How Reverse Osmosis Works
The RO process begins with pre-treatment, where sediment and carbon filters remove larger particles and chlorine, which can damage the membrane. The core of the system is the RO membrane itself, where high pressure is applied to the water, forcing it through the membrane. The resulting output is purified water, while the contaminants are flushed away.
Types of Reverse Osmosis Systems
- Under-Sink Systems: These are compact units installed beneath the kitchen sink, providing purified water directly from the faucet.
- Whole-House Systems: Designed to supply purified water to every faucet in the home, these systems offer comprehensive filtration but require a larger setup.
- Point-of-Use Systems: Similar to under-sink models, these systems treat water at the consumption point, ensuring high purity for drinking and cooking.
Environmental Impact of Reverse Osmosis Systems
While reverse osmosis systems provide clean drinking water, they also generate wastewater, which can raise concerns regarding environmental sustainability. Understanding how to minimize water wastage and recycling practices can enhance the eco-friendliness of these systems. Some manufacturers are developing more efficient membranes that reduce wastewater production, making RO systems more sustainable.
Future Innovations in Reverse Osmosis Technology
The field of reverse osmosis continues to evolve with advancements in membrane technology, energy efficiency, and smart home integration. Researchers are exploring ways to increase the permeation rate of membranes, enhance contaminant rejection, and reduce energy consumption, paving the way for more efficient and user-friendly RO systems.
